Understanding the Challenges of Faith-Filled Relationships
In a world where values can often clash, the challenge of maintaining a faith-filled relationship becomes increasingly significant. Here are some key factors to consider:
- Social Media Influence: The rise of social media has created a culture of quick interactions, often overshadowing deeper connections.

- Geographic Barriers: Many Catholics find themselves isolated in areas with fewer practicing believers.
As these challenges surface, it’s essential to uphold our commitment to faith when looking for a partner. The right relationship can flourish when both individuals prioritize shared beliefs and values.
Faith Integration in Relationships
Integrating faith practices into relationships is key for those of us seeking meaningful connections. Prayer, for instance, can be a powerful tool in fostering intimacy and understanding between partners. Here’s how you can incorporate faith into your dating life:
- Pray Together: Sharing prayer can create a spiritual bond that nurtures the relationship.
- Attend Mass Together: Participating in the Eucharist as a couple deepens the spiritual commitment.
- Discuss Faith Topics: Open conversations about faith can strengthen your connection and understanding of each other.
By making faith an integral part of your relationship, you not only honor your beliefs but also create a strong foundation for the future. It’s inspiring to witness how faith can guide us through challenging moments together.
The Role of Theology of the Body in Catholic Dating
The Theology of the Body offers profound insights that can shape our relationships in beautiful ways. This teaching emphasizes the dignity of the human person and the importance of viewing relationships through the lens of love and respect. Here are some key aspects to consider:
- Understanding Human Dignity: Recognizing the value of each person fosters respect in your relationship.
- Emphasizing Intimacy: The Theology of the Body encourages healthy expressions of intimacy based on mutual respect.
- Connecting Love and Sacrifice: True love involves self-giving, which can strengthen the bond between partners.
Incorporating these principles into your dating life can help you build a relationship that honors not only your partner but also your faith. As we embrace these teachings, we can create a culture of love that reflects God’s intentions for our lives.

Q3: What is the Theology of the Body, and why is it important for Catholic dating?
The Theology of the Body is a teaching from the Catholic Church that emphasizes the dignity of the human person and the importance of love and respect in relationships. It guides Catholics to understand human dignity, healthy intimacy, and the connection between love and sacrifice, fostering relationships that honor both partners and God's intentions.

Engaging with the Catholic Community through Parish Events
Participating in parish events is one of the most rewarding ways to build connections within the Catholic community. Here are some engaging activities that can help:
- Faith-sharing groups: Join small groups that discuss scripture and faith topics.
- Volunteer opportunities: Serve others in your community, fostering a sense of fellowship.
- Social gatherings: Attend church picnics, retreats, or youth events to meet like-minded individuals.
- Prayer groups: Engage in communal prayer, strengthening your spiritual life and connections.
These events not only provide opportunities to meet potential partners but also help foster a sense of belonging.
